What is Checkatrade Express?
An alternative experience to the ordinary Checkatrade website. It has a simplified booking journey for customers, with a focus on quick, everyday jobs in the home. Prices are fixed and upfront, payment is made with us directly on the platform, and the customer does not select their trade - we handle that for them.
We built the platform in mid-2025, and brought it to market in Q4 of that year. We have since grown extremely quickly, expanded nationwide, and offer 100+ services to thousands of customers. The product is still very early in its journey. It is run by a small, ambitious, entrepreneurial team with aggressive targets to hit. About us
We’re Checkatrade – the UK’s leading platform for finding a tradesperson. With more than 50,000 trades listed and over 6 million reviews, we help homeowners get jobs done right and help tradespeople grow their business.
